The bar-like restaurant offers quite a huge seating capacity. You can choose to sit outside that has a huge projector TV or leisure around cushion seating enjoying a glass of beer.


The chef doing some flaming on those skewers. They are specialize in skewer flame grilling with a varieties of meat ranging from chicken, seafood, beef, lamb to sausage and even vegetables.

They sell a wide range of alcohol but since we not much of an alcohol fans, we settled for some fresh juices. At RM10, it is rather expensive for a slightly larger than standard size glass.

We ordered the Skewers Special Garlic Butter Prawn RM23, which comes with some pasta, mashed potato and fresh salad. The prawn was fresh, seasoning was on the mild side, taste was okay. But I felt it doesn’t have much grill/burnt taste.

Next up, the Minty Lamb skewer at RM24 was just average. Again there was not much grill/burnt taste in it, seasoning was lacking and some of the meat was pretty tough to chew at.

The Ultimate Skewers Glutton Burger received many recommendation from those blogs that I read hence I gave this a try. At RM23, it is pretty competitive to those huge burgers at Chilis. You get a big beef patty with fried egg, cheddar cheese, chilli con carne, tortilla chips, jalapenos and gherkins on top. The burger tasted okay but what truly stand out was the accompany Seasoned Steak Fries. Crispy on the outside, while hot and soft at the inside, the fries was good!

Overall for the price that we were paying, I expected the food to taste much better. Especially when comes to grill food, it has to be strong in taste and those signature burnt taste that usually associated with this kind of food preparation.
Best dish of the night has to be the dessert, the Tiramisu Brandy cake was really good. The taste of the alcohol Brandy was strong and the texture of the cake was smooth and soft.

Thanks to my sis for treating us the meal. The bill came out to be around RM130++ including tax, and we gotten a 15% discount for being a Digi user. But still, not a cheap dinner!

Location:
Skewers are located at the ground floor of Subang Avenue, corner and facing outside.
